Senator Jeremiah Tumbut Useni has said that President Muhammadu Buhari the right things to put Nigeria on track as; “prosperity awaits the future of the country.”

He said there is lot dirt in the country, which requires cleansing for it to be good, calling on Nigerians to think well for the oneness of the country.

Senator Useni stated this on Saturday evening at his Jos residence in his goodwill message during an independence anniversary get together organized at his instance.

“What President Buhari is doing is good, and we must support what his doing,” Useni said. “Nigeria is so dirty, and so those that are thinking differently they are deceiving themselves.”

The senator said senators are also doing their best and Nigeria will soon get out of its hardships that it is into.

According to Useni the anniversary is being celebrated in a low key; “so that we can meet and think more on how to keep Nigerian one.”

“Celebrating October 1st is paramount because it was a day of self-emancipation from the dependent rules of our colonialist, who had been at the helm of our inherent affairs, including absolute control of our Commonwealth.

“The journey so far has been so tough, yet the achievements are enormous  and un-quantifiable to mention, hence the reasons why we must celebrate with absolute appreciation to Almighty God, for HIS guidance, protection and keeping us as one indivisible nation,” he said.

Senator Useni said with genuine political will, sincerity of purpose and; “togetherness we can do better as a nation despite all odds disturbing our nation-hood, having being able to surmount our past challenges.”

While felicitating with President Muhammadu Buhari (GCFR), Senate President Abubakar Bukola Saraki, Governor of Plateau State Simon Bako Lalong, as well as the entire Nigerian’s, Useni implored all Nigerian’s to collectively strive hard towards attaining; “greatness for prosperity awaits the future of the country.”

Useni explained that it is nonsense for politicians to resort to fighting each other on the basis of political differences that is all about interest, adding that he organized the  get together not on the basis of politics.

He urged Nigerians and the People of Plateau State to embrace one another and promote the course of peace.
